Make a Difference

The Patient Relations Advocate acts as a liaison between Community Health Network patients family members or visitors to capture the voice of the healthcare consumer and share these experiences with network representatives. The Advocate works to communicate facetoface by phone and by written or electronic communication means as an input and output of feedback and must have excellent communication skills. Processing feedback from healthcare consumers is managed by the Advocate to maintain compliance with regulatory bodies support review efforts and coordinate alongside leaders the service recovery efforts when applicable. The Advocate is an integral part of the assessment and consult to ensure Community Health Network is actively listening and interpreting what the healthcare consumer is sharing with our teams as we improve processes designed to enhance the health and wellbeing of the communities we serve.

Exceptional Skills and Qualifications

Applicants for this position should be able to collaborate with others in a team setting have excellent communication skills and a positive attitude toward patient experience.

  • Five 5 or more years of customer service experience .
  • Bachelors Degree (Clinical Business Psychology Sociology etc..
  • In lieu of the above requirements a combination of experience and education will be considered.
  • Community Health Worker Certification preferred.
  • Exceptional communication relationship and analytical skills fortelephonic and email transactions.
  • Ability to communicate effectively with patients families staff and physicians to build relationships problem solve and provide an exceptional experience.
  • Strong interpersonal skills and empathy.
  • Strong problemsolving aptitude motivated to solve issues on first contact.
  • Working knowledge of patient billing in EMR applications.
  • Advocates for the best possible care outcomes and patient/family expectations.
